Vulnerability Description
Cisco Firepower Management Center 6.0.1 has hardcoded database credentials, which allows local users to obtain sensitive information by leveraging CLI access, aka Bug ID CSCva30370.

What is CVE-2016-6434?
CVE-2016-6434 is a vulnerability with a CVSS score of 7.8 (HIGH). Cisco Firepower Management Center 6.0.1 has hardcoded database credentials, which allows local users to obtain sensitive information by leveraging CLI access, aka Bug ID CSCva30370.
How severe is CVE-2016-6434?
CVE-2016-6434 has been rated HIGH with a CVSS base score of 7.8/10. Review the CVSS metrics above for detailed severity breakdown.
